Transaction 1228108236ea9149026ebe048fd8e6b9cf8b0a66a8fb998bd1069acd104836b7

1 Input
2 Outputs
  • 1228108236ea9149026ebe048fd8e6b9cf8b0a66a8fb998bd1069acd104836b7:0
  • value  4926583856
    address  2MxfTrPne99ffhnaN9JnqGZ9xc8GexZ1CqP
  • 1228108236ea9149026ebe048fd8e6b9cf8b0a66a8fb998bd1069acd104836b7:1
  • value  826366
    address  2N5ma8ncw4KSWW2gmZJwiMe4gPycdtTAL8k